Does anyone know what (PBR) in superscript stands for in taxonomy (beer is
not the topic)?
For example:
On the RHS database, they list:
Clematis Golden Tiara
as the preferred selling name for
Clematis 'Kugotia' (PBR-superscripted)
I understand that Golden Tiara is the trademark name (or, as they show, the
preferred selling name) and that this should not be shown with single
quotes. The single quotes are reserved for use with the plants botanical
cultivar name, the name given it by the person who selected or developed
it. Usually I'll see a superscript R or TM after the seling name, but what
is the superscripted (PBR) after the botanical name?
Hi Kitty, It stands for 'Plant Breeder's Rights'; if I remember correctly, it's an Aussie/New Zealand thing and doesn't have legal bearing here.
